Output af073e5e7b8f65ea2813dd81483c4b9a7b62cc2afb8898554af74e20d280f8fe:0

value
378391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b69a58c203a80083829c0acdca439bdfb6d75a61 OP_EQUAL
address
3JLXoeuStY8nyDeg9M3a35tRCdaXMBZapF
transaction
af073e5e7b8f65ea2813dd81483c4b9a7b62cc2afb8898554af74e20d280f8fe
confirmations
345493
spent
true